=*org/adempiere/impexp/AbstractExcelExporterjava/lang/ObjectlogLorg/compiere/util/CLogger; m_workbook,Lorg/apache/poi/hssf/usermodel/HSSFWorkbook; m_dataFormat.Lorg/apache/poi/hssf/usermodel/HSSFDataFormat; m_fontHeader(Lorg/apache/poi/hssf/usermodel/HSSFFont; m_fontDefaultm_langLorg/compiere/util/Language; m_sheetCountI m_colSplit m_rowSplitcurrentRowOnlyZm_stylesLjava/util/HashMap; SignatureTLjava/util/HashMap;colSuppressRepeats[Ljava/lang/Boolean; noOfParameter isFunctionRow()ZgetColumnCount()I getRowCount setCurrentRow(I)V getCurrentRowisColumnPrinted(I)Z getHeaderName(I)Ljava/lang/String;getDisplayType(II)I getValueAt(II)Ljava/lang/Object; isPageBreak(II)Z isDisplayed()VCode 4 01 6 78getClass()Ljava/lang/Class; :<;org/compiere/util/CLogger => getCLogger.(Ljava/lang/Class;)Lorg/compiere/util/CLogger; @  B D F  H  J  L  N Pjava/util/HashMap O4 S  U W*org/apache/poi/hssf/usermodel/HSSFWorkbook V4 Z  V\ ]^createDataFormat0()Lorg/apache/poi/hssf/usermodel/HSSFDataFormat; ` LineNumberTableLocalVariableTablethis,Lorg/adempiere/impexp/AbstractExcelExporter;getCtx()Ljava/util/Properties; hjiorg/compiere/util/Env ef setFreezePane(II)VcolSplitrowSplit getLanguage()Lorg/compiere/util/Language; j hs ot4(Ljava/util/Properties;)Lorg/compiere/util/Language; StackMapTablegetFont+(Z)Lorg/apache/poi/hssf/usermodel/HSSFFont; Vy z{ createFont*()Lorg/apache/poi/hssf/usermodel/HSSFFont; }~&org/apache/poi/hssf/usermodel/HSSFFont setBold(Z)V   }  setItalicisHeaderfontgetFormatString-(Ljava/text/NumberFormat;Z)Ljava/lang/String;java/lang/StringBuilder 4 java/text/NumberFormat getMinimumIntegerDigits getMaximumIntegerDigits0 insert.(ILjava/lang/String;)Ljava/lang/StringBuilder;#, getMinimumFractionDigits getMaximumFractionDigits. append-(Ljava/lang/String;)Ljava/lang/StringBuilder; toString()Ljava/lang/String; 0(Ljava/lang/String;)V;[RED]- java/util/logging/Level FINESTLjava/util/logging/Level; :  isLoggable(Ljava/util/logging/Level;)Z java/lang/String valueOf&(Ljava/lang/Object;)Ljava/lang/String; makeConcatWithConstants&(Ljava/lang/String;)Ljava/lang/String; : finestdfLjava/text/NumberFormat;isHighlightNegativeNumbersformatLjava/lang/StringBuilder;integerDigitsMinintegerDigitsMaxifractionDigitsMinfractionDigitsMaxfLjava/lang/String;getStyle1(II)Lorg/apache/poi/hssf/usermodel/HSSFCellStyle;  )* (II)Ljava/lang/String; O get&(Ljava/lang/Object;)Ljava/lang/Object;+org/apache/poi/hssf/usermodel/HSSFCellStyle V createCellStyle/()Lorg/apache/poi/hssf/usermodel/HSSFCellStyle;  vw setFont+(Lorg/apache/poi/hssf/usermodel/HSSFFont;)V 'org/apache/poi/ss/usermodel/BorderStyle THIN)Lorg/apache/poi/ss/usermodel/BorderStyle;  setBorderLeft,(Lorg/apache/poi/ss/usermodel/BorderStyle;)V  setBorderTop setBorderRight  setBorderBottom   getCellFormat ,org/apache/poi/hssf/usermodel/HSSFDataFormat    getFormat(Ljava/lang/String;)S    setDataFormat(S)V O put8(Ljava/lang/Object;Ljava/lang/Object;)Ljava/lang/Object;rowcol displayTypekeycs-Lorg/apache/poi/hssf/usermodel/HSSFCellStyle; cellFormat org/compiere/util/DisplayType &isDate  op " #$ getDateFormat:(Lorg/compiere/util/Language;)Ljava/text/SimpleDateFormat; &('java/text/SimpleDateFormat ) toPattern + ,& isNumeric . /0getNumberFormat8(ILorg/compiere/util/Language;)Ljava/text/DecimalFormat; 2 Ljava/text/DecimalFormat;getHeaderStyle0(I)Lorg/apache/poi/hssf/usermodel/HSSFCellStyle;7 ( 9 :MEDIUM<text > ? getBuiltinFormat A B setWrapText cs_header font_headerfixColumnWidth-(Lorg/apache/poi/hssf/usermodel/HSSFSheet;I)V HJI'org/apache/poi/hssf/usermodel/HSSFSheet K#autoSizeColumnsheet)Lorg/apache/poi/hssf/usermodel/HSSFSheet;lastColumnIndexcolnumScloseTableSheet?(Lorg/apache/poi/hssf/usermodel/HSSFSheet;Ljava/lang/String;I)V T EF V WisForm HY ZlcreateFreezePane \^]org/compiere/util/Util _`isEmpty(Ljava/lang/String;Z)Z Vb cd setSheetName(ILjava/lang/String;)V f gWARNINGi j'(ILjava/lang/String;)Ljava/lang/String; :l mC(Ljava/util/logging/Level;Ljava/lang/String;Ljava/lang/Throwable;)Vojava/lang/Exception prevSheet prevSheetNamecolCountprevSheetIndexeLjava/lang/Exception;createTableSheet+()Lorg/apache/poi/hssf/usermodel/HSSFSheet; Vy zw createSheet | }~ formatPage,(Lorg/apache/poi/hssf/usermodel/HSSFSheet;)V  ~createHeaderFooter  ~createParameter  ~createTableHeader java/lang/Math *max  F H  createRow*(I)Lorg/apache/poi/hssf/usermodel/HSSFRow;  %& %org/apache/poi/hssf/usermodel/HSSFRow  createCell+(I)Lorg/apache/poi/hssf/usermodel/HSSFCell;  45 &org/apache/poi/hssf/usermodel/HSSFCell  setCellStyle0(Lorg/apache/poi/hssf/usermodel/HSSFCellStyle;)V  '(0org/apache/poi/hssf/usermodel/HSSFRichTextString    setCellValue/(Lorg/apache/poi/ss/usermodel/RichTextString;)V    headerRowNum colnumMax'Lorg/apache/poi/hssf/usermodel/HSSFRow;cell(Lorg/apache/poi/hssf/usermodel/HSSFCell;stylestrgetNoOfParametersetNoOfParameter H  getHeader,()Lorg/apache/poi/hssf/usermodel/HSSFHeader; (org/apache/poi/hssf/usermodel/HSSFHeader page  numPages 8(Ljava/lang/String;Ljava/lang/String;)Ljava/lang/String;  setRight H  getFooter,()Lorg/apache/poi/hssf/usermodel/HSSFFooter; h $getStandardReportFooterTrademarkText (org/apache/poi/hssf/usermodel/HSSFFooter setLeftZK_FOOTER_SERVER_MSG h getAD_Client_ID(Ljava/util/Properties;)I org/compiere/model/MSysConfig getValue9(Ljava/lang/String;Ljava/lang/String;I)Ljava/lang/String; h +(Ljava/util/Properties;I)Ljava/lang/String;   setCenter org/compiere/util/Msg parseTranslation<(Ljava/util/Properties;Ljava/lang/String;)Ljava/lang/String;java/sql/Timestamp java/lang/System currentTimeMillis()J  0(J)V ZK_FOOTER_SERVER_DATETIME_FORMAT  '(Ljava/lang/String;I)Ljava/lang/String; & java/lang/Long (J)Ljava/lang/Long; &   # ;(ILorg/compiere/util/Language;)Ljava/text/SimpleDateFormat; &  $(Ljava/util/Date;)Ljava/lang/String;header*Lorg/apache/poi/hssf/usermodel/HSSFHeader;footer*Lorg/apache/poi/hssf/usermodel/HSSFFooter;snowLjava/sql/Timestamp; H  setFitToPage H  getPrintSetup0()Lorg/apache/poi/hssf/usermodel/HSSFPrintSetup; ,org/apache/poi/hssf/usermodel/HSSFPrintSetup   setFitWidth " # setNoColor % & setPaperSize ( ) setLandscapeps.Lorg/apache/poi/hssf/usermodel/HSSFPrintSetup;isCurrentRowOnlysetCurrentRowOnlybexport(Ljava/io/OutputStream;)V Exceptions 3 vw V5 67 getSheetAt,(I)Lorg/apache/poi/hssf/usermodel/HSSFSheet; H9 :  getLastRowNum < , > $ @ ! B  D "# F +, H I. isVisible K L&isSuppressNull  O PQ getFormRowS(Lorg/apache/poi/hssf/usermodel/HSSFSheet;I)Lorg/apache/poi/hssf/usermodel/HSSFRow; S TU getFormCellR(Lorg/apache/poi/hssf/usermodel/HSSFRow;I)Lorg/apache/poi/hssf/usermodel/HSSFCell; W X getColumnIndex Z [getCell ] ^&isSetFormRowPosition ` /. bdcjava/lang/Boolean e booleanValue g hiequals(Ljava/lang/Object;)Zk java/sql/Date jm ngetTime p q(Ljava/util/Date;)Vsjava/lang/Number ru vw doubleValue()D y z(D)V|Y gN  getMsgB(Lorg/compiere/util/Language;Ljava/lang/String;)Ljava/lang/String;   -.  getRichStringCellValue4()Lorg/apache/poi/hssf/usermodel/HSSFRichTextString;   getString  QR V 0write java/io/OutputStream 1close  FINE7 : fine O  size7outLjava/io/OutputStream; sheetNamerownum lastRowNum preValues[Ljava/lang/Object; printColIndexinitxls_rownum xls_rownumobjLjava/lang/Object;labelindexvalueDorg/compiere/util/Language-(Ljava/io/File;Lorg/compiere/util/Language;)V  /.(Ljava/io/File;Lorg/compiere/util/Language;Z)VfileLjava/io/File;languageReport_.xls  java/io/File createTempFile4(Ljava/lang/String;Ljava/lang/String;)Ljava/io/File;java/io/FileOutputStream  0(Ljava/io/File;)V  /0 org/compiere/util/Ini isClient  toURI()Ljava/net/URI;  java/net/URI h  startBrowserautoOpenLjava/io/FileOutputStream;exportToWorkbookK(Lorg/apache/poi/hssf/usermodel/HSSFWorkbook;Lorg/compiere/util/Language;)Vworkbook SourceFileAbstractExcelExporter.javaBootstrapMethods $java/lang/invoke/StringConcatFactory (Ljava/lang/invoke/MethodHandles$Lookup;Ljava/lang/String;Ljava/lang/invoke/MethodType;Ljava/lang/String;[Ljava/lang/Object;)Ljava/lang/invoke/CallSite;NumberFormat: cell--header-Error setting sheet  name to  /  Sheets #Styles used # InnerClasses%java/lang/invoke/MethodHandles$Lookupjava/lang/invoke/MethodHandlesLookup!    * ! "#$ %&'()*+,-./.012Y*3**59?*A*C*E*G*I*K*M*OYQR*T*VYXY**Y[_a:#(-2=BMXb Ycdef2.gab cdkl2Q *I*Ka b  cd m nop2R*E**qrE*Eab cduvw2]M%*A**YxA*A|*AM6**YxM,|,*C**YxC*CM,aB  %(/7<ADKV[b ]cd][ u  }2 ̻YN+6+66.-W -W -W+6+66* -W -W -W-:YN*?*?--ab!,4:BLRX^cjq{bp cd5RzXt[1u'   $2T*>:*R:a*Y:*:*:*_ *RWaB#,3:BJRZ b g u bRcd}tf3N buu} 2C>*6:*!%:**-:*1:a&   !,7@"bHCcdCCA 9 67 3u $452c6M*R,N-M*:*YN--8-8-8-8-;= -@*R,-W-a:+,-./&0,132:3A4H5R6W7a9b4ccdc\PCCD u aEF2v> +G`>aCE CGb*cdLMNOPu QR2t}+*+S*I *K,*U%+*I *I*K *KX,[5*G.*Gd6*Y,a:*?e,hkYcfna2 QRT U VBWQXYZc[f\h]|`b>}cd}pM}q}rY#shtuua UHHH HHHH#Hnvw2/*YxL*+{*+*+*U*+*YG`G+a"hi jkln#p-rb/cd'LMu#H~2F*+*Ta z {bcdLMF2= b>+:66I>*4:*:*: Y *a>  $-5<DRUabf bcdbLMb` Y VOR-(5 D uH9 2/*Tab cd#2>*Ta bcd~25abcdLM~2P+M,+N-Ͷ׸gٸ:[-*q-gY:gٸ:[-&Y-* a: 1:IUaoxb>cdLM1saCuI ;}~2v ++M,,!, $,'a b  cd LM *+,2/*Mab cd-2>*Ma bcd./01n2[M+ *2M"**Y[_*Y4M*,,8`N6*; *=6*; *=`*?6:6*A *A:6 +*T`6 *T`,8`6  6 *; *C6 , : 66 6;  6*$:*E:*U*Gr*JdM[X*,N: * R:*:[RYV`6 Y:- :!*\*,N:   :*6*_ *A *A2aS*A*A2a2f*G3:jYjl: :o*"9r rt9xeI6bba6 {}6Y* {~M:Y!*:*U @*6 N *A S* *,-*2M6 6  y+ *,S *,-+*Y++*?&*?*G*?*Rai "-/2CY\_fp s w  "#%&(*+%,--6/D0M1V2[3d5g6p8y:|=@ABCEGIJKLNO P#Q+R.S6T@VGWJXQYTZ\[i]s^_abefghilmnqrsxyz{|(,6>BJN[k~bcd}LM/P2MC<Y&\#_ s   m- e _O D-7Mh*.T@u+H@C H DT &   HuuHuu  H//1n2J*+,a b cd/1n28*,E+ LY+:*ϙ +Զظ۱a" #-7b48cd888u #1n2Z*,E*+Y*ͱa b cdW2,ab cdI.2@ab cdL&26abcd^&26abcdTU2@ab cdOPQ2@ab cdLMO,